Stanford Design Process
Stanford design thinking is a human centered approach that emphasises on empathy, so it is more appropriate for my app. All stages of Standard design thinking will justify to develop an app for students, as it needs to connect with the users as much as possible.
Empathy is the first stage which motivated me to develop a solution. At this stage I am defining the problem. It is helping me to identify the core challenges or opportunities that needs to be addressed for students.
The ideation process will help me generate a range of possible solutions to the defined problem from different perspective. In prototyping, creating low fidelity designs and quickly testing them & then to iterate on ideas to learn what works and what doesn’t. Gathering feedback and validate assumptions will help to refine and improve the final solution

Main Features of this App
-
Information Page: Central hub for valuable insights.
-
Navigation System: Easy access to various functionalities.
-
Food Page: Curates unique culinary experiences in London.
-
Event Page: Highlights local activities and events.
-
Part-Time Jobs Feature: Addresses job search needs, filling a market gap.
-
Counselling Page: Considered but deemed non-essential based on user feedback.
-
Search Bar: Simplifies navigation across the app.
-
Notification Bar: Keeps users updated on events and community connections.
-
Privacy Policy: Protects user information, enhancing security.
-
Account Tab: Customizable based on user interests.
-
Review and Rating Systems: Helps users make informed decisions.
-
Bookmarking: Allows users to save preferences.
-
Chat Box: Facilitates user engagement and connection with others.

A mood board visually captures the desired aesthetic and emotional tone of a website portfolio, featuring images, colors, and typography to guide design decisions. Complementing this, a style guide provides detailed guidelines for design elements like spacing and iconography, ensuring consistency across the site. Brand colors are essential for establishing identity and evoking emotions, reinforcing recognition and usability. Lastly, brand values define the principles that inform messaging and design choices, ensuring the portfolio authentically represents the creator’s mission. Together, these elements create a cohesive online presence that resonates with potential clients and reflects the creator's unique vision.
